The Economist Who Solved the Free-Rider Problem

Summary by Jacobin
Defenders of capitalism argue that cooperation is undermined by individuals’ tendency to take more from society than they contribute. The economist Elinor Ostrom refuted this idea, but without identifying capitalism as the real cause of exploitation. Elinor Ostrom speaking at a conference in New Delhi, India, on January 5, 2011.
